Choosing the Ideal Rooflight Styles for Various Room Types
Choosing the right rooflight style can significantly improve the functionality and ambiance of different types of rooms. For kitchen spaces, larger, fixed rooflights permit generous amounts of natural light, giving the room a welcoming and vibrant feel. In sitting rooms, a blend of rooflights and openable windows can offer airflow while preserving a warm ambiance. For bathroom spaces, smaller, frosted rooflights provide seclusion without compromising illumination, establishing a peaceful setting.
For bedrooms, rooflights with adjustable blinds help control light levels, creating a restful atmosphere. Home office or study spaces benefit from rooflights that can be opened for fresh air, encouraging concentration and productivity. Ultimately, choosing the right rooflight style entails addressing the particular needs of every room, including light, privacy, and ventilation. By adjusting decisions according to these considerations, homeowners can significantly enhance both comfort and energy efficiency across their living spaces.
How to Install Rooflights for Maximum Efficiency
Installing rooflights can significantly improve energy efficiency when done correctly. To begin with, proper placement is vital; placing rooflights to make the most of natural light while reducing heat loss will yield the best results. In most cases, they should be installed on southward-facing slopes to make the most of sunlight during the day.
Furthermore, selecting energy-efficient, high-quality glazing is essential. Double or triple-glazed solutions equipped with low-emissivity coatings will aid in sustaining indoor temperatures while cutting down on energy use.
In addition, guaranteeing a proper bond around the rooflight prevents unwanted drafts and moisture ingress, which might undermine overall efficiency.
Additionally, considering the use of thermal barriers and shading elements will considerably increase overall performance, creating enjoyable living environments throughout the year.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Are the Maintenance Requirements for Rooflights?
Rooflights require regular inspections covering leak detection, debris clearance, and sealant assessment. Washing the glass panels improves natural light transmission, while ensuring proper drainage avoids water pooling. Routine maintenance increases durability and enhances functionality, contributing to overall building efficiency.
Are Rooflights Able to Help Lower Heating and Cooling Expenses?
Skylights can considerably decrease utility bills by maximizing daylight and improving air circulation. This results in diminished need for electric lighting and heating or cooling equipment, ultimately resulting in lower energy bills and enhanced interior comfort levels.
Do Certain Rooflight Materials Help Improve Energy Efficiency?
Certain rooflight options, such as low-emissivity coatings and triple-glazed glass, greatly enhance thermal performance. These solutions decrease heat transfer, helping to stabilize indoor temperatures and lower reliance on heating and cooling systems.
